Pricing FAQ

Is Serpaix really free forever?
Yes. The full desktop and mobile app with local AI, knowledge graph, Obsidian import, voice recording, OCR, and FSRS-4.5 learning is free, MIT-licensed, and never times out. Cloud sync and multi-device access are the only paid features — and you can self-host those for free.
Can I self-host the entire platform?
Yes. Serpaix is MIT-licensed open source. The full Docker Compose stack (Postgres + pgvector, Redis, backend, OCR worker, Prometheus, Grafana) ships in the public monorepo. Self-hosting requires running the stack on infrastructure you control; we provide the configuration and migrations.
Does my data ever leave my device?
By default, never. Notes, voice recordings, and captures stay on your device. The Rust LTM daemon strips PII before any data reaches a server. Cloud sync is opt-in, and all synced data is encrypted with AES-256-GCM before leaving your machine.
Which AI providers are supported?
Groq (Llama 3.3 70B, default for hosted), OpenAI (GPT-4o), Anthropic (Claude), or any local model via Ollama. Switch providers per-session or globally. Local AI shows a privacy badge so you always know data is staying on-device.
What is the MCP Server and is it included?
Yes, included in every plan. The MCP Server exposes your Serpaix knowledge base to Claude Desktop, Cursor, and any MCP-compatible client. When Claude asks about your data, it queries your actual memories — not the internet.
